Transaction 17890b500adebfb37aedb3931e4581d0503c1da65453bcd0bbc641504e870ff9

1 Input
2 Outputs
  • 17890b500adebfb37aedb3931e4581d0503c1da65453bcd0bbc641504e870ff9:0
  • value  23672222
    address  3EgHg7T5Lgxihhd4iwGcXP99cDcLR1VMkg
  • 17890b500adebfb37aedb3931e4581d0503c1da65453bcd0bbc641504e870ff9:1
  • value  24309130
    address  3NGpDtsMNF2THUejFkfJwXYYiipZC7Y6q1